I have a 93 Z-28 and had to replace the fuel pump.

As of now I have all the items disconnected (exhaust, heat shields, fuel lines, etc.) I took out both bolts holding the tank straps in place, pulled them down and the tank did not move.

I noticed that the tank straps adhered to the tank (kind of like double sided tape) and had to be pulled off.

Is there something similar on the top of the tank? Should I just pull harder on the tank?
